Modern/Contemporary: With straight clean lines and angular cuts, contemporary and modern furniture is void of any flourishes and embellishments
Transitional: A bit softer than modern tables and less ornate than traditional design, transitional tables feel at home in any outdoor setting.
Traditional: Ranging from dark finishes and ornate craftsmanship to large intricately woven wicker pieces, traditional furniture is a stately choice
Rustic: From log furniture to Southwestern style, these tables look great on any lakefront.
Tropical/Exotic: Features carefully woven rattan designs and tropical fabrics
